Stockport County took a significant step towards Wembley with a last-gasp 1-0 victory over Stevenage in the first leg of their League One play-off semi-final at the Lamex Stadium on Saturday. A calamitous defensive error in stoppage time gifted the visitors the win, leaving Stevenage with a mountain to climb in the second leg.

The match had been a tightly contested affair, reflecting the narrow two-point gap between the sides in the regular season. Chances were few and far between, with both defenses largely on top. The game appeared destined for a goalless draw until the dying moments of added time.

Substitute Benony Andresson had a golden opportunity to break the deadlock but slipped at the crucial moment. However, Stockport midfielder Ben Osborn kept his composure, continuing his run and capitalizing on a massive mix-up in the Stevenage backline to poke the ball home from close range.

“It's probably one of the ugliest goals the play-offs has ever seen, but it's valuable in that it puts us ahead in the tie,” Stockport boss Dave Challinor told Sky Sports. “Credit to Ben to follow the play up after 90-odd minutes and get that bit of luck. He showed you should never give up on anything.”

The goal was a bitter blow for Stevenage, who had defended resolutely throughout. Former EFL defender Luke Chambers described it as “disastrous” and noted that it matched the overall quality of the game. “There was some real sloppiness in the way that goal has come about,” he added.

Stockport now hold a slender advantage heading into the second leg at Edgeley Park on Wednesday night, which will be broadcast live on Sky Sports Football. The match kicks off at 8pm, with the winner advancing to the play-off final at Wembley.
